  • Double Dutchess
    Double Dutchess Album by Fergie
     0    0
    rank #5 ·
    Double Dutchess is the second studio album by American singer and rapper Fergie. It was released on September 22, 2017. The album is the singer's first to be released under her own imprint, Dutchess Music, in a partnership with Retrofuture Productions and BMG Rights Management, and first since her solo debut, The Dutchess (2006). Promotion for the album began with the release of the album's first single "L.A. Love (La La)" in late 2014. "M.I.L.F. $" was released as the second single from the album in July 2016, followed by the release of "Life Goes On" in November that same year. "You Already Know" was released as the fourth single on September 12, 2017. The album includes collaborations with Nicki Minaj, YG, Rick Ross, and Fergie's son Axl Jack.
  • Reputation
    Reputation Album by Taylor Swift
     0    0
    rank #6 · 3
    Reputation (stylized in all lowercase) is the sixth studio album by American singer-songwriter Taylor Swift. It was released on November 10, 2017, and was her last album under Big Machine Records. Swift conceived the album amidst rampant tabloid scrutiny on her personal life and celebrity following her fifth studio album, 1989 (2014); she secluded herself from the press and social media, where she had maintained an active presence, and created the album as an effort to revamp her state of mind.
  • Concrete and Gold
    Concrete and Gold Album by Foo Fighters
     0    0
    rank #7 ·
    Concrete and Gold is the ninth studio album by American rock band Foo Fighters, released on September 15, 2017, through Roswell and RCA Records. It is the band's first album to be produced alongside Greg Kurstin. Described by the band as an album where "hard rock extremes and pop sensibilities collide", Concrete and Gold concerns the future of the United States from the viewpoint of the band's frontman and lead songwriter Dave Grohl, with the heated atmosphere of the 2016 elections and the presidency of Donald Trump cited as major influences by Grohl. Juxtapositions serve as a common motif in both the album's lyrical and musical composition, with Grohl further describing the album's overall theme as "hope and desperation".
